Chapter 8836. FAYETTE COUNTY GROUNDWATER CONSERVATION DISTRICT |
Subchapter C. POWERS AND DUTIES |
Sec. 8836.102. REGIONAL COOPERATION
-
To provide for regional continuity, the district shall:
(1) participate in coordination meetings with adjacent districts on an as-needed basis;
(2) coordinate the collection of data with adjacent districts in such a way as to achieve relative uniformity of data type and quality;
(3) coordinate efforts to monitor water quality with adjacent districts, local governments, and state agencies;
(4) provide groundwater level data to adjacent districts;
(5) investigate any groundwater and aquifer pollution with the intention of locating its source;
(6) notify adjacent districts and all appropriate agencies of any detected groundwater pollution;
(7) annually provide to adjacent districts an inventory of water wells and an estimate of groundwater production within the district; and
(8) include adjacent districts on the mailing lists for district newsletters, seminars, public education events, news articles, and field days.
